With Superman being recast for upcoming DC movies and Henry Cavill stepping down from The Witcher series, speculation about his next big franchise role is rife on the internet. While rumors suggest possibilities like playing James Bond or characters in upcoming Marvel movies such as Captain Britain and Doctor Doom, an impressive piece of fan art has sparked my interest in seeing Cavill as Wolverine. The uncertainty surrounding the Justice League actor’s next move adds to the excitement, and I can’t help but hope he transitions from DC to Marvel to embody this iconic Weapon X.

A striking piece of fan art shared on Instagram depicts Cavill brilliantly reimagined as Logan for the Marvel Cinematic Universe. Given Cavill’s iconic portrayal of The Man of Steel in the now-defunct DCEU, his transition to another superhero role feels timely, particularly with David Corenswet stepping into the Superman role for James Gunn’s revamped DC Universe. The artist, known as @21xfour on the platform, has skillfully crafted a vision of Cavill wielding the adamantium claws and sporting the mutton chops famously worn by Hugh Jackman for over 25 years.

Wow, what an incredible piece of art! The idea of someone other than Hugh Jackman stepping into the role of Wolverine might initially seem unthinkable, given Jackman’s iconic portrayal. However, when you combine this fan art with Henry Cavill’s impressive track record, it’s easy to see how he could do justice to the character.

The notion of Cavill, known for his roles in “Man From U.N.C.L.E,” taking on the legendary X-Man isn’t as far-fetched as it might seem. With details about the forthcoming Deadpool and Wolverine movie being kept under wraps, speculation runs wild, fueling excitement and anticipation. A recent rumor even suggests Cavill could potentially don the claws as a variant of Logan, adding to the intrigue surrounding the project.

While we should approach such rumors with caution, the prospect of Cavill adopting Wolverine’s iconic look, especially after seeing this fan art, has fans eagerly awaiting the release of Deadpool & Wolverine in the 2024 movie schedule on July 26.

Whether Cavill joins the MCU or not remains uncertain, but fans won’t have to wait long to see him in his next high-profile project on the big screen. In “The Ministry Of Ungentlemanly Warfare,” Cavill portrays Gus March-Phillips, the real-life inspiration for James Bond. Directed by Guy Ritchie, the action-packed film tells the true story of a secret British group during World War II whose unconventional tactics against the Germans played a pivotal role in shaping modern covert operations.

With such exciting projects on the horizon, including the possibility of Cavill as Wolverine, fans have plenty to look forward to. In the meantime, catch “The Ministry Of Ungentlemanly Warfare” in theaters on April 16 for a thrilling cinematic experience.
